I’m pressing on the upward way

by Johnson Oatman Jr · by Hnij Ujui'nu

Representative text

As printed in The Seventh-day Adventist Hymnal (1985), no. 625.

Verse 1

I’m pressing on the upward way, New heights I’m gaining every day; Still praying as I’m onward bound, “Lord, plant my feet on higher ground.”

Refrain

Lord, lift me up, and I shall stand By faith, on heaven’s tableland; A higher plane than I have found; Lord, plant my feet on higher ground.

Verse 2

My heart has no desire to stay Where doubts arise and fears dismay; Though some may dwell where those abound, My prayer, my aim, is higher ground.

Verse 3

I want to live above the world, Though Satan’s darts at me are hurled; For faith has caught the joyful sound, The song of saints on higher ground.

Verse 4

I want to scale the utmost height And catch a gleam of glory bright; But still I’ll pray till heaven I’ve found, “Lord, lead me on to higher ground.”
